Model description Requirements - ComfyUI (recent - tested on master 0.31.0) - ComfyUI-LoraInt8Loader custom node (standard ComfyUI LoRA loaders cannot dequantize it) Files - Both are quantized from the KJ comfy-converted BF16 LoRA. - LightX2V Release norefiner variant The full LoRA also patches the model's tokenrefiner - the text/audio conditioning refiner. The norefiner variant removes those 8 patches so the conditioning path runs at base quality (some video clips had bad audio. This solution fixed it, but keep in mind it doesn’t happen always). If audio/text conditioning feels weak with the full LoRA at 4 steps, try the norefiner variant. First clip: with refiner | last clip: norefiner Your browser does not support the video tag. Usage (ComfyUI) 1. Unzip the ComfyUI-LoraInt8Loader custom node into customnodes, restart 2. In your MiniMax H3 workflow, add LoRA Loader (Int8-ConvRot), select the file, strength 1.0 (the training scale is already baked in) 3. Sample at 4-6 steps Download model Download them in the Files & versions tab.
